Block

#18,296,868
Block Number
18,296,868 @ 04/13/2024, 09:21:40
Status
Finalized
ID
0x011730249402cb6824e992289ae4dda9c237e2fe7fe6cdd45c04f3653fb08c3a
Transactions
Gas Used
0/30000000 (0.00% Used)
Total Score
150,707,484 (+14)
Rewards
0.00 VTHO